Output 1284a6b1e5cdbf4cc2a3096b59db4552ad3c932f955f9e668c86e72201afe451:2

value
23760614
script pubkey
OP_0 OP_PUSHBYTES_20 669248dab5d5c22b167873d5ebaa3d2ea15422bf
address
bc1qv6fy3k446hpzk9ncw027h23a96s4gg4l64e2q4
transaction
1284a6b1e5cdbf4cc2a3096b59db4552ad3c932f955f9e668c86e72201afe451